Answer to Question 1

ANS: B
Clients with somatoform disorders go from doctor to doctor trying to establish a physical cause for
their symptoms. When a psychological basis is suggested and a referral for counseling is offered,
these clients reject both. Thus, options A, C, and D are incorrect.

Bisphosphonates were first developed in the nineteenth century. They were first investigated for use in disorders of bone metabolism in the 1960s. They are now used clinically for the treatment of osteoporosis, Paget's disease, bone metastasis, multiple myeloma, and other conditions that feature bone fragility.
